#d1208e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1208e is composed of 82% red, 12.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 322.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#d1208e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#a3001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d1208e color description : Strong pink.

#d1208e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d1208e has RGB values of R:209, G:32,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.32,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13705358.

Shades and Tints of #d1208e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1208e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e737a is the less saturated color, while #ed0495 is the most saturated one.
